uPVC windows can experience issues opening or locking.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ism has become stiff or jammed. If this is the case, a simple solution is to apply graphite powder or machine oil to grease the lock and handle mechanism. This will allow the lock mechanism to be unlocked and the door or window to function normally once again.

Another issue that often arises with uPVC windows is that the hinges can become stiff or even stuck. This issue is typically caused by dust and grit building up on the hinges. The solution is to lubricate the hinges using oil or grease. The wrong lubricant can damage the hinges and render them inoperable.

Repairs to Stained Glass

Stained glass windows are located in homes, churches and other structures. They can add visual interest as well as privacy and light to an area. They are fragile and require regular maintenance to ensure they remain in good shape. Even with the best care, stained and lead glass windows degrade as they age due to aging and exposure to the elements and weather elements. This causes a range of issues like cracks, fading, and water leakage. It is important to seek out a local expert to restore your stained or leaded window to its original beauty.

The cost of repairing c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The exact price will depend on the kind of solution needed to fix the issue. For instance professional technicians may use copper foil or Window Repairs Near Me epoxy edge-gluing to repair the broken glass. They may also re-lead the lead cames and reseal the stained glass. There are many options to choose from and each one has distinct advantages and costs. The best choice is based on the size, location, and type of glass used.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, building movement, or simply normal wear and tear. The cracks can enlarge and create larger problems over time. To prevent further damage and enlargement, a crack that is located across an important feature of stained-glass panels or their face must be repaired as soon as is possible. In the past, this was done by splicing an "Dutchman's" lead flange onto the crack. This was not a good solution, and today there are more effective methods to repair these types of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a highly specialized art that can take many forms. It can be as easy as repairing a chip, or as complex as making a stained glass door panel or window back to its original state. In general, the cost of a restoration project is considerably more than that of a simple repair or replacement. The project involves cleaning and removing damaged glass, tightening lead cames, resealing the cement and re-tying it, and replacing stained glass pieces that are missing.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ping stops water and air from entering homes through the gaps surrounding doors and windows. It's an essential part of home maintenance and can prevent the need for costly repairs or bills for energy, as well making a home more comfortable. The materials used to make the seal may degrade over time, due to wear and tear. It is crucial to replace these materials periodically.

You can detect if your weather stripping has worn down by noticing a spot that is wet after washing your windows, a whistling noise while driving, or a draft that you can feel when you are in front of an unlocked door. These are all indications that it's time for a Tasker who offers weatherstripping repair near me.

Taskers can protect your doors and windows by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are made of closed or open-cell foam and come in a range of thicknesses, widths, and quality to accommodate any crack. They are simple to install and can be cut using scissors. Felt strips are also affordable and last for about a year or two. They can be cut to length with scissors and glued to the door frame or hinge side of a double-hung or sliding window repair near me with glue, staples or tacks. Metal or vinyl V strips are a little more difficult to set up, but can be nailed along the window jamb.

One of the most common issues that occur with double-paned windows is the fogging of the glass. This is due to a breakdown of the airtight seal that connects the two panes of glass. Re-sealing the glass may be able to fix the problem, depending on the cause. However, if the window was exposed to the elements for a long period of time, it may be necessary to replace the entire unit.
